PUL-I-KHUMRI: (Pajhwok): The shortage of equipment forced security personnel to make a tactical retreated and allowed the Taliban
to capture the Dand-i-Ghori locality in southe Baghlan province, an official said on Friday.
Ferozuddin Amaq, the provincial council member told Pajhwok Afghan New, security forces had captured the area from the Taliban during Khursid 20 military offensive, but it was lost again to the rebels on Thursday.
A unite of Afghan National Army (ANA) had evacuated their base without resistance due to the lack of equipment, while another unit stained in the province did not provided support promptly.
Meanwhile, the Taliban Spokesman Claimed 31 security policemen surrendered to the group in Dand-i-Ghori.
Earlier, Heavy clashes erupted oveight between security forces and Taliban militants on the outskirts of the provincial capital of northe Baghlan province, with the rebels capturing some areas, officials and residents said on Thursday.
The clashes broke out in Dand-i-Shahabuddin and Dand-i-Ghori localities of Pul-i-Khumri, the capital city, after the insurgents stormed security forces posts on Wednesday night, an official said.
Police Chief Brig. Gen. Mohammad Ewaz Naziri told Pajhwok Afghan News the Taliban captured some areas and security forces launched an operation codenamed “Navida” to retake the captured areas.
Naziri did not say if Dand-i-Ghori was lost to Taliban, but the rebels had apparently captured most of its parts.
